There seems to be a new wave of 2nd Generation Stars in WWE right now. I want to know which ones you think will hit and which ones will fall short of expectations. And what would you think of starting a stable with all the 2nd Generation wrestlers? Heres a list of the 2nd Generation stars currently in WWE.
Carlito- Son of Carlos Colon Deuce- Son of Jimmy Snuka Cody Rhodes- Son of Dusty Rhodes D.H. Smith- Son of the British Bulldog Jesse- Son of Terry Gordy Also Ted Dibiase Jr. is coming up through the farm leagues of WWE.

WWE "Kayfabe" has always been the same as real life in regards to Rey. He was always Rey Jr. out of respect to his uncle but a few years ago his uncle gave him permission to drop the "Jr." from his name. He technically is not a 2nd gen star in kayfabe or RL. During the Mysterio-Psyhcosis match at ONS1, Mick Foley and Joey Styles talk extensivily about this.
